Bei der Webentwicklung ist es oft notwendig, auf den gesamten HTML-Inhalt einer Webseite oder eines Dokuments zuzugreifen. Unabhängig davon, ob Sie die HTML-Struktur manipulieren oder wichtige Informationen extrahieren möchten, kann es von entscheidender Bedeutung sein, zu verstehen, wie Sie diesen Inhalt als Zeichenfolge erhalten.
Um dies in JavaScript zu erreichen, stellt das Dokumentobjekt Methoden bereit, die Ihnen den Zugriff ermöglichen das Stammelement und rufen Sie sein HTML-Markup ab. Lassen Sie uns in die Details eintauchen:
Die Eigenschaft document.documentElement stellt das Stammverzeichnis dar. Element der Webseite. Durch Zugriff auf dieses Element können wir den gesamten HTML-Inhalt innerhalb seiner Tags abrufen.
Zum Extrahieren des HTML stehen zwei Methoden zur Verfügung:
So rufen Sie den HTML-Inhalt als Zeichenfolge mit .innerHTML ab:
// Get the root <html> element const htmlElement = document.documentElement; // Extract the HTML content const htmlString = htmlElement.innerHTML;
So rufen Sie den HTML-Inhalt ab, einschließlich < ;html> Element mit .outerHTML:
// Get the root <html> element const htmlElement = document.documentElement; // Extract the HTML content with the <html> tag const htmlString = htmlElement.outerHTML;
Diese Methoden bieten eine einfache Möglichkeit, auf den HTML-Inhalt einer Webseite als Zeichenfolge zuzugreifen und ermöglichen verschiedene Vorgänge wie Parsing, Manipulation und Datenextraktion.
Das obige ist der detaillierte Inhalt vonWie rufe ich den HTML-Inhalt einer Webseite als String in JavaScript ab?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!